  • Jennifer Lawrence speaks as part of the award presentation to Honorary Award recipient Donald Sutherland at the 2017 Governors Awards in the Ray Dolby Ballroom at Hollywood & Highland in Hollywood, CA, Saturday, November 11, 2017.
